0

私のモデルクラスでは public DateTime GoalDate { get; set; }

私のビュークラスで私が持っている

 @Html.TextBoxFor(model => model.weightGoalDate

私のコントローラーに私が持っている

 var newGoal = new Goal();

            newGoal.bpGoalDate = DateTime.Now ;

私が望むのは、目標日を現在の日付の 1 週間後に設定し、ページの読み込み時にテキスト ボックスに表示することです。

たとえば、ページをロードすると、今日は 2012 年 7 月 25 日であるため、日付は自動的に 2012 年 8 月 1 日に設定されます。

4

1 に答える 1

3

使用AddDays方法

public ActionResult SomeAction()
{
  var newGoal=new Goal();
  newGload.GoalDate =DateTime.Now.AddDays(7);
  return View(newGoal);  
}

msdn から、

指定された日数をこのインスタンスの値に加算する新しい DateTime を返します。

于 2012-07-25T16:26:35.987 に答える